Permit 90/BB-0065 Located on a hill overlooking Honolulu and the majestic Diamond Head crater, this two bedroom, two and half bath plus bonus sleeping space in Manoa Valley features gorgeous custom touches and a large lanai that’s perfect for a barbecue. Custom stained glass and teak accents make for a uniquely stylish Old Hawaii-style interior. Hardwood floors lead into cream carpets in the living room, furnished with a love seat and oversize armchair. Additional furnishings include a teak desk and a 30” TV great for movie nights after a day spent wandering nearby Makiki-Manoa Cliffs. Enjoy your evenings out on the lanai which includes a six-person dining table and a charcoal grill. Stainless steel appliances and granite counters in the well-appointed kitchen. Original cabinetry showcases throughout, and a working antique phone hangs on the wall. The raised formal dining room features a table for six beneath a classic chandelier. Custom designed stained glass landscapes and seascapes adorn the walls. This rental has a sitting room with a king-size Hawaiian daybed and a 38” TV. There is also a bedroom with a queen-size bed, 32” TV, and an en-suite bathroom with a double vanity, a soaking tub, and a separate walk-in shower. Another bedroom is perfect for the kids with a twin-over-full bunk set, a 26” TV, and an en-suite bathroom with a pedestal sink and walk-in shower. A convenient half bathroom is available. This pet-friendly is a Pet friendly home (for an additional fee). Extras include complimentary Wi-Fi, cable TV, AC throughout the home, and a shared washer/dryer. One parking spot is offered in the driveway. Additional parking may also be available on the street on a first-come, first-serve basis. Manoa Valley is close to breathtaking hiking trails and countless tasty cafes. Prefer to spend your day relaxing or playing at the beach? Magic Island is just 2.5 miles from your door, and Kaimana Beach is 3 short miles away as well. Honolulu Museum of Art 's impressive international art collection offers a stimulating afternoon just 5 minutes away by car. *Please note as of 10.10.21 the unit no longer includes a Jacuzzi that is referenced in some of the review.
